#856750 color RGB value is (133,103,80). #856750 color name is Custom Color color.

#856750 hex color red value is 133, green value is 103 and the blue value of its RGB is 80.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#856750 hue: 0.07, saturation: 0.25 and the lightness value of 856750 is 0.42.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#856750 color hex is 0.00, 0.23, 0.40, 0.48. Web safe color of #856750 is #996666. Color #856750 contains mainly ORANGE color.

About #856750 Custom Color

#856750 (Custom Color) is a orange-based color with RGB values of 133, 103, 80. This color belongs to the orange color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#856750,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#856750 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#856750), RGB (rgb(133, 103, 80)), HSL (hsl(26, 25%, 42%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#996666,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
